B-450 White Progressive Serie : Amazing, affordable and accessible active bass
I can't be any happier with this bass. I've played guitar for two years prior to buying this bass and it's such a joy to play.
The neck feels smooth and accessible due to the comfortable cutaways and relatively slim profile and the bass feels comfortable both sitting down and standing up.
The sound of these active pickups surprised me. They are very versatile and provide me with all the sounds i'll need for 99% of my favorite rock and metal songs. Off course there are better sounding basses out there, but definitely not at this pricepoint.
The only reason i'ts not 5/5 for the finish is a buzzing D-string. The nut slot of this string is cut ever so slightly too deep resulting in some fret buzz if i'm attacking the string, mostly when playing metal and punk rock. This is easily solved by fitting a new nut, which are anything but expensive, and i don't see this being a consistent error with these basses. The rest of the bass is finished great for this price.
Overall an amazingly versatile and solid bass, which is accessible enough for beginners and will probably satisfy most experienced players on a budget.
